We are going keyless this September - Here’s what you need to know
Starting in mid September all external access to our church buildings will be through electronic key cards utilizing the installed card readers. At that time all the traditional key locks will be deactivated and external access to our buildings will no longer be possible with the current metal keys. Pakistan Flood Victims
The massive flooding in Pakistan has affected 17 million people with over a million homes damaged or destroyed and six million people desperately needing food assistance. The UCC is working through the Church World Service to bring relief to the area. … read more
